So lets call what you are talking about LF or 125kHz or xEM
Programming wise, you may or may not need to, also if you do, you have a couple of options
Not Need To: If what you are interacting with is LF, and it is EM mode and you own it, you can probably just enroll it into the equipment
Need to If what you are interacting with is LF, but it is in another mode eg. indala or HID you will need to change the mode to match ( Programming )
Tools Generally if you need to change your xEM to HID mode, you could PROBABLY get away with a Blue cloner ( I could expand, but lets keep it simple, so Search the forum for things to be aware of ) if you need any other modes, you will probably need a Proxmark ( Easy $60 or RDV4 $300 )

Things to consider, with your Ulton Kit, It is awesome, and this is hindsight, but for Magic :mage: I would have recommended for you a flex device, The reason being is for the extended range. so your interaction will be more hands off, with your current implants you with likely need to touch what you are interacting with.
Your phone and NFC will obviously give you some options, but with some lock I will suggest you could build props around them, but a FLEX will give you some better effects.
image
these are spring loaded, they do some LF versions but HF are more abundent
The HF ones I think are compatible with the HF - xNT side of your NExT, I have a couple but they are at work so I don’t have access to them, and I haven’t tried to enroll them…

image
These are also spring loaded but not as strong, these are normally LF and also EM so you will be able to enroll directly without a programmer

Yes. Glass coated magnet. No RFID capabilities.

They need at least 5mm clearance. Magnets may negatively impact the read range of a implant though I don’t know if the xG3 would be strong enough to be noticeable.
